Argo - the eternally cheerful dog! His age is not at all visible in his temperament, he is in excellent condition and has a lot of energy. Very grateful, slightly crooked-headed old dog. If you want to be the owner of an inexhaustible energetic happy dog, then Argo is an ideal choice. Only for a single dog, will not accept any other animals.

🇭🇺Adopting from Hungary

Hungarian shelters operate at high capacity given the country's stray population. Animals leave sterilized, chipped, and with a passport. Many shelters coordinate transport to Germany, Austria, and the Nordics.

Can I adopt Mit tudunk róla if I live in another country?
Yes, in most cases. Rescues across Europe routinely place animals abroad — Misina Állatmenház Pécs will tell you what they need (EU pet passport, rabies titer, transport coordination) and whether they handle transport themselves or refer you to a partner. Plan for an extra €100–€350 in transport costs depending on distance.
